import * as model from "./index";
/**
* Represents the mapi calendar time zone rule.
*/
export declare class MapiCalendarTimeZoneInfoDto {
/**
* Attribute type map
*/
static attributeTypeMap: Array<{
name: string;
baseName: string;
type: string;
}>;
/**
* Returns attribute type map
*/
static getAttributeTypeMap(): {
name: string;
baseName: string;
type: string;
}[];
/**
* Time zone's offset in minutes from UTC.
*/
bias: number;
/**
* Offset in minutes from lBias during daylight saving time.
*/
daylightBias: number;
/**
* Date and local time that indicate when to begin using the DaylightBias.
*/
daylightDate: model.MapiCalendarTimeZoneRuleDto;
/**
* Offset in minutes from lBias during standard time.
*/
standardBias: number;
/**
* Date and local time that indicate when to begin using the StandardBias.
*/
standardDate: model.MapiCalendarTimeZoneRuleDto;
/**
* Individual bit flags that specify information about this TimeZoneRule. Items: Enumerates the individual bit flags that specify information about TimeZoneRule. Enum, available values: TzRuleFlagRecurCurrentTzReg, TzRuleFlagEffectiveTzReg
*/
timeZoneFlags: Array<string>;
/**
* Year in which this rule is scheduled to take effect.
*/
year: number;
/**
* Represents the mapi calendar time zone rule.
* @param bias Time zone's offset in minutes from UTC.
* @param daylightBias Offset in minutes from lBias during daylight saving time.
* @param daylightDate Date and local time that indicate when to begin using the DaylightBias.
* @param standardBias Offset in minutes from lBias during standard time.
* @param standardDate Date and local time that indicate when to begin using the StandardBias.
* @param timeZoneFlags Individual bit flags that specify information about this TimeZoneRule.
* @param year Year in which this rule is scheduled to take effect.
*/
constructor(bias?: number, daylightBias?: number, daylightDate?: model.MapiCalendarTimeZoneRuleDto, standardBias?: number, standardDate?: model.MapiCalendarTimeZoneRuleDto, timeZoneFlags?: Array<string>, year?: number);
}
